diff --git a/roles/wazuh/ansible-wazuh-agent/tasks/Debian.yml b/roles/wazuh/ansible-wazuh-agent/tasks/Debian.yml index 87112798..81062d80 100644 --- a/roles/wazuh/ansible-wazuh-agent/tasks/Debian.yml +++ b/roles/wazuh/ansible-wazuh-agent/tasks/Debian.yml @@ -1,9 +1,4 @@ --- - -- include_tasks: "../roles/wazuh/ansible-wazuh-agent/tasks/installation_from_sources.yml" - when: - - wazuh_sources_installation.enabled - - name: Debian/Ubuntu | Install apt-transport-https and ca-certificates apt: name: @@ -25,7 +20,7 @@ when: - ansible_distribution == "Ubuntu" - ansible_distribution_major_version | int == 14 - - not wazuh_sources_installation.enabled + - not wazuh_sources_installation.enabled - name: Debian/Ubuntu | Installing Wazuh repository key apt_key: diff --git a/roles/wazuh/ansible-wazuh-agent/tasks/Linux.yml b/roles/wazuh/ansible-wazuh-agent/tasks/Linux.yml index 5cd95ff4..0c1f8e5f 100644 --- a/roles/wazuh/ansible-wazuh-agent/tasks/Linux.yml +++ b/roles/wazuh/ansible-wazuh-agent/tasks/Linux.yml @@ -1,4 +1,8 @@ --- +- include_tasks: "../roles/wazuh/ansible-wazuh-agent/tasks/installation_from_sources.yml" + when: + - wazuh_sources_installation.enabled + - include_tasks: "RedHat.yml" when: ansible_os_family == "RedHat" diff --git a/roles/wazuh/ansible-wazuh-agent/tasks/RedHat.yml b/roles/wazuh/ansible-wazuh-agent/tasks/RedHat.yml index 36984115..13b1b3e8 100644 --- a/roles/wazuh/ansible-wazuh-agent/tasks/RedHat.yml +++ b/roles/wazuh/ansible-wazuh-agent/tasks/RedHat.yml @@ -1,9 +1,4 @@ --- - -- include_tasks: "../roles/wazuh/ansible-wazuh-agent/tasks/installation_from_sources.yml" - when: - - wazuh_sources_installation.enabled - - name: RedHat/CentOS 5 | Install Wazuh repo yum_repository: name: wazuh_repo